Two queer Afghan people detained by Taliban while trying to leave country

Summary by GCN
This article is about queer people being detained by Taliban. In the photo, a protest for Afghanistan with people holding flags and signs. Via Unsplash - Ehimetalor Akhere Unuabona According to reports, two queer people were detained by the Taliban in Afghanistan after they were found at Kabul airport as they were trying to leave the country.
